WebJul 16, 2014 · 表示方法 1. 下面每行语句表达语义相同,只是选用不同的进制数表示。 int i = 0b101010; // binary int i = 052; // octal int i = 42; // decimal int i = 0x2a; // hexadecimal 2. 使用 strtol/strtoll/strtoq 函数,可以将一个字符串转换成整数,base 取 2 表示转换成二进制数。 #include long int strtol (const char *nptr, char **endptr, int base); long long int … WebJan 14, 2010 · 数字0到9用二进制位表示分别为0=0,1=01,2=10,3=11,4=100,5=101,6=110,7=111,8=1000,9=1001。 十进制转换为二进制 …
二进制 - 知乎
WebDec 15, 2016 · 二进制的表示 首先在Python中可以通过以"0b"或者"-0b"开头的字符串来表示二进制,如下所示 print 0b101 # 输出5 print 0b10 # 输出2 print 0b111 # 输出7 print -0b101 # 输出-5 由此可知我们用二进制表示的数字在打印之后会变成我们更为熟悉的十进制数,更容易被人理解。 当我们需要看十进制数字的二进制表示时,可以使用bin函数 bin (5) # 输 … Web1、二进制 是计算技术中广泛采用的一种数制。 二进制数据是用0和1两个数码来表示的数。 它的基数为2,进位规则是“逢二进一”,借位规则是“借一当二”,由18世纪德国数理哲学大师莱布尼兹发现。 当前的计算机系统使用的基本上是二进制系统,数据在计算机中主要是以补码的形式存储的。 计算机中的二进制则是一个非常微小的开关,用“开”来表示1,“关”来表 … buy light sticks
为什么0.1+0.2=0.30000000000000004而1.1+2.2=3. ... - 知乎
Web八进制与二进制数之间的对应就是上面表格中十六进制的前八个数。 二进制数000就是八进制数0,二进制数111就是八进制数7,以此类推。 八进制转为二进制: 65 8 = 110 101 2 17 8 = 001 111 2 二进制转八进制: 101100 2 = 101 100 2 (三位一组) = 54 8 10011 2 = 010 011 2 (用零 填充 (密码学) ,三位一组) = 23 8 八进制化为十进制 [ 编辑] 遵循二进制化为十 … WebMay 17, 2024 · 二进制 一个1 或 0 叫 一 “位” 8 位 最大是 255,最小是0 8 位 专门的名字: 字节 (byte) 1 字节 = 8 位 1 bytes = 8 bits 千字节(kb) 兆字节(mb) 千兆字节(gb) 第一位 1 整数 0 负数。 32 位 64 位 内存标记 计算机必须给内存中每个位置做一个标记 ,叫 “位址” ,方便存取数据。 处理 非整数浮点数。 浮点数表示: IEEE 754 标准。 625.9 = 0.6259 … Web逻辑运算操作数集合有两个元素,true和false,二进制也只有两个基本计数符号,1和0。 如果用1表示true,0表示false,我们来看看一位二进制数的计算情况: 加法(不考虑进位): 逻辑异或: 0+0=0----------------->0⊕0=0 0+1=1------------------>0⊕1=1 1+0=1------------------>1⊕0=1 1+1=0------------------>1⊕1=0 减法(不考虑借位): 逻辑异或: 0-0=0--------------- … buy light stand